Why Cleanliness Matters in Probiotic Supplements
While probiotics are celebrated for their potential gut-health benefits, the quality of these supplements can vary dramatically. The ingredients that accompany the beneficial bacteria are crucial, as some additives can counteract the positive effects or cause adverse reactions. Choosing a clean, high-quality probiotic involves being vigilant about the inclusion of certain substances that can harm the gut microbiome, trigger allergies, or simply serve as unnecessary fillers. A probiotic supplement is meant to improve health, not introduce potential risks from low-quality, contaminated, or unsuitable ingredients.
Artificial Sweeteners and Sugars
One of the most counterproductive ingredients found in many commercial probiotic products is sugar or artificial sweeteners. Sugar, in particular, feeds harmful bacteria and yeast in the gut, which can undermine the purpose of taking a probiotic in the first place. Artificial sweeteners like aspartame and sucralose can also disrupt the gut microbiome and cause digestive discomfort. For individuals with diabetes or phenylketonuria (PKU), avoiding these sweeteners is especially critical.
- Aspartame and Sucralose: Can alter gut bacteria and lead to digestive issues.
- High-Fructose Corn Syrup and Refined Sugar: Can promote the growth of harmful bacteria, potentially negating the probiotic's benefits.
Unnecessary Fillers, Binders, and Additives
Many manufacturers add cheap fillers, binders, and other additives to their products to increase bulk, improve texture, or extend shelf life. These ingredients are not only unnecessary but can also be harmful. Your supplement should be as clean and pure as possible to maximize efficacy.
- Magnesium Stearate and Silicon Dioxide: Common fillers that offer no health benefit.
- Titanium Dioxide: A coloring agent with no purpose in a health supplement.
- Carrageenan and Sodium Benzoate: Artificial preservatives that can have negative health effects.
Common Allergens
For individuals with food sensitivities, checking the label for common allergens is paramount. Probiotics can sometimes be grown on mediums containing dairy or soy, which can then be present in the final product.
- Dairy and Lactose: Some probiotics contain lactose, which can cause bloating and gas for individuals with lactose intolerance. Dairy-free options are available for those with milk allergies or sensitivities.
- Soy and Gluten: Traces of these allergens can be present, and people with celiac disease, gluten intolerance, or soy allergies should choose certified-free products.
Certain Prebiotics
While prebiotics are generally beneficial as a food source for probiotics, they can cause side effects for some people. This is especially true for those with conditions like Small Intestinal Bacterial Overgrowth (SIBO) or Irritable Bowel Syndrome (IBS), who may find that prebiotics worsen their symptoms.
- Fructooligosaccharides (FOS) and Inulin: Common prebiotics that can cause bloating and gas in sensitive individuals.
- Lactulose and Galactooligosaccharides (GOS): Other prebiotics to watch out for if you experience discomfort from high-fiber supplements.
How to Identify Quality Probiotics
Choosing the right probiotic requires a little due diligence. Here's a quick guide to help you compare your options.
| Feature | Look for This | Avoid This | 
|---|---|---|
| Ingredients | A short, clean list of bacteria strains, plus a prebiotic if desired (and tolerated). | A long list of artificial colors, flavors, sugars, and fillers. | 
| Strain Information | Genus, species, and strain listed (e.g., Bifidobacterium lactis Bi-07). | Only genus and species listed, with no specific strain identifier. | 
| Potency (CFU) | CFU count guaranteed through the expiration date, not just at the time of manufacture. | CFU count guaranteed only at the time of manufacture, which will likely decrease over time. | 
| Allergen Info | Clear labeling for common allergens like dairy, soy, and gluten, especially if you have sensitivities. | Vague or missing allergen information on the label. | 
| Delivery System | Enteric-coated or delayed-release capsules for better survival through stomach acid. | Simple vegetable capsules that offer little protection for the live cultures. | 
| Third-Party Testing | Indication of third-party testing for purity and potency. | No mention of third-party testing or quality assurance measures. | 
The Takeaway
Selecting a probiotic shouldn't be based solely on the number of CFUs. The quality of the formulation, the presence of unnecessary or harmful ingredients, and your own body's sensitivities all play a critical role. By being an informed consumer and reading labels carefully, you can avoid products with hidden sugars, allergens, and fillers, and instead choose a supplement that truly supports your gut health goals.
